The core appeal lies in its straightforward mechanics. Players place a bet and watch as a plane takes off, ascending on a continuously rising curve. The longer the plane stays airborne, the higher the multiplier, and consequently, the potential payout increases. However, the plane can crash at any moment, causing players to lose their stake if they haven't cashed out beforehand. This element of unpredictability is what makes the game so compelling, and understanding the nuances of the game is crucial for maximizing your chances of success. The Martingale and Fibonacci Strategies
Two popular betting strategies often employed in the aviator game are the Martingale and Fibonacci sequences. The Martingale strategy invol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the aim of recovering your previous losses and making a profit when you eventually win. While potentially effective in the short term, the Martingale strategy requires a substantial bankroll and can quickly lead to significant losses if you encounter a prolonged losing streak. The Fibonacci sequence, on the other hand, involves increasing your bet according to the Fibonacci numbers (1, 1, 2, 3, 5, 8, etc.) after each loss. This strategy is less aggressive than the Martingale and offers a more conservative approach to risk management. Both strategies require discipline and a clear understanding of their limitations.

Psychological Aspects of the Game
The aviator game isn't just about mathematical probabilities; it also involves a significant psychological element. The thrill of watching the multiplier climb can be incredibly addictive, and it's easy to get caught up in the moment and overextend your bets. Fear of missing out (FOMO) can also lead players to delay cashing out, hoping to reach a higher multiplier, only to see the plane crash before they can collect their winnings. Recognizing these psychological biases is crucial for making rational decisions. Maintaining a calm and objective mindset is essential for successful gameplay. Don’t let emotions dictate your actions.
